Transaction e151fc40592cbdb044635d4c7bc054330c1f7198992351e68af0a114d151d65a
1 Input
1 Output
-
e151fc40592cbdb044635d4c7bc054330c1f7198992351e68af0a114d151d65a:0
- value
- 3899140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3832f94f5d2ae8e4c007f4123be28520be646d89 OP_EQUAL
- address
- 36pAq1gniJmcEBR825hHpUGZACikvzJMdc